Detect IgM antibodies specific for VZV. These IgM antibodies, if present, can help confirm a diagnosis of VZV acute infection. The IgM response to VZV can be detected at seven days postinfection and usually peaks at 14 days. If a patient presents more than nine days after the appearance of a rash, this assay should not be used.
